Abstract. Hemoproteins are widely distributed among prokaryotes, unicellular eukaryotes, plants and animals . Myoglobin, a cytoplasmic hemoprotein that is restricted to cardiomyocytes and oxidative skeletal myofibers in vertebrates, has been proposed to facilitate oxygen transport to the mitochondria . This cytoplasmic hemoprotein was the first protein to be subjected to definitive structural analysis and has been a subject of long-standing and ongoing interest to biologists . Recently, we utilized gene disruption technology to generate mice that are viable and fertile despite a complete absence of myoglobin . This unexpected result led us to reexamine existing paradigms regarding the function of myoglobin in striated muscle.
